
If you have a long layover at Incheon International Airport (ICN), don’t worry—you won’t be bored! As one of the best airports in the world, Incheon offers plenty of activities to keep travelers entertained. Whether you have a few hours or an entire day, here are the best ways to make the most of your time.

Relax in a Transit Hotel or Spa
Tired from your flight? Incheon Airport has transit hotels where you can rest and freshen up. If you prefer a quick refresh, visit Spa on Air, a 24-hour spa offering showers, massages, and even sleeping rooms. Perfect for recharging before your next flight!

Enjoy Free Cultural Experiences
Incheon Airport offers free cultural programs for transit passengers. Try on a hanbok (traditional Korean dress), learn Korean crafts, or watch live performances. These activities are a great way to experience Korean culture without leaving the airport.

Explore the Airport’s Shopping & Dining Scene
From luxury brands to Korean souvenirs, Incheon’s duty-free shops are a shopper’s paradise. Don’t miss out on Korean skincare products and local snacks like honey butter chips. For food lovers, try authentic Korean dishes like bibimbap, kimchi stew, or Korean fried chicken at one of the many restaurants.

Take a Free Transit Tour
If you have 5+ hours, consider joining a free transit tourorganized by the airport. Options include trips to Incheon’s Chinatown, Songdo Central Park, or even Seoul’s major attractions like Gyeongbokgung Palace. Just make sure your layover is long enough to return in time for your next flight!

Unwind at the Ice Skating Rink or Movie Theater
Yes, Incheon Airport has an ice skating rink (seasonal) and a free movie theater! If you’re traveling with kids or just want some fun, these are great ways to pass the time.

Stay Connected with Free Wi-Fi & Lounges
Need to catch up on work? Incheon Airport provides free high-speed Wi-Fi and business lounges with charging stations. Some lounges even offer showers and nap areas for added comfort.
